The three layers of ROI for AI agents Labor efficiency is just the starting point for AI agent ROI, not the endgame. While agents offer 70-90% cost savings per task, immediate headcount reduction isn't realistic due to messy human workflows. The real early wins come from improved customer satisfaction, faster response times, and reduced employee burnout. |

It’s time for modern CSS to kill the spa Native CSS transitions and View Transitions API now deliver smooth page animations without JavaScript bloat. While average Next.js sites ship 1-3MB bundles with 3-5s load times, modern MPAs achieve sub-1s performance with 0KB JavaScript. The browser already solved what SPAs were trying to fix. |

Making Postgres 42,000x slower because I am unemployed Chaotic headline but Jacob's experiment shows how few misconfigured tweaks can destroy Postgres performance. He adjusted 32 parameters, including shared_buffers, autovacuum settings, and WAL configurations, to reveal which settings have the most dramatic impact on database performance. |

A peek into my debugging process (with real examples) iOS developer shares debugging process through three real-world examples from their apps. Covers everything from mysterious crashes with unclear stack traces to performance regressions and unexpected system permission prompts. Emphasizes that most debugging time is spent finding issues, not fixing them. |

Six Principles for production AI agents Building reliable AI agents requires system design over prompt tricks. Focus on clear instructions, minimal context, robust tools, and feedback loops. When agents frustrate you, debug the system first. Missing tools or unclear prompts are usually the culprits, not model limitations. |

Copyparty Copyparty transforms any device into a powerful file server supporting resumable uploads/downloads, WebDAV, FTP, media indexing, thumbnails, and search functionality through any web browser, requiring only Python with all dependencies optional. |

FlowGram.AI FlowGram.AI is a node-based flow building engine that enables developers to quickly create visual workflows using either fixed layout or free connection modes, with AI capabilities and interaction best practices built-in. |

Lingo.dev Lingo.dev is an open-source, AI-powered i18n toolkit that provides instant localization for web and mobile apps using LLMs, featuring a compiler, CLI, CI/CD integration, and SDK for real-time translation. |

es-toolkit es-toolkit is a modern, high-performance JavaScript utility library that's 2-3 times faster than lodash with 97% smaller bundle size, offering tree-shaking support, TypeScript integration, and comprehensive utility functions. |
